Senior Cycle Science, MSD Tour
Some of our 5th and 6th year Biology & Physics students visited the impressive MSD plant in Ballydine on Thursday 27th November. MSD kindly facilitated a presentation and a guided tour of the facility. The students got to view the world class facilities such as the 3D printing lab and also observed the varied career opportunities available in MSD such as Engineering , Pharmaceutical Science, Maintenance , Logistics and HR. A very enjoyable experience for all !!

EU Ambassador Programme
As part of the EU Ambassador Programme, our TY students explored the EU’s role in everyday life, from funding local heritage and community projects to supporting education, travel rights, digital protection, and environmental initiatives. The posters displayed here represent only a section of their overall project work, showcasing their research into how the EU impacts their region, their opportunities as young people, and Ireland’s place within Europe.

Hope Shoe Box Appeal
Our students have shown wonderful generosity by collecting and preparing dozens of gift-filled shoeboxes for this year’s Team Hope Shoebox Appeal. Each box was carefully packed with toys, toiletries, stationery, and sweets for children in need around the world. This appeal plays an important role in bringing joy, dignity, and a sense of hope to children who may otherwise receive very little at Christmas. TY CPR/First Aid Training
Our Transition Year students recently took part in an engaging and practical CPR and First Response training session. The workshop focused on essential life-saving skills, including how to respond in emergency situations, perform CPR effectively, and use an AED. Students gained hands-on experience and confidence in dealing with real-life scenarios, making this an invaluable part of their TY programme.
